which was launched on 2 February 2015. Fajr had a mass of 52 kg and was equipped with an optical imaging payload which would have reached a ground resolution of about . It is the first Iranian satellite to use a cold-gas thruster system, to conduct orbital maneuvers and increase its service life by raising its orbit to prevent a fast decay. An experimental GPS system developed by Iran is also part of the spacecraft. The Fajr satellite is expected to operate for 1.5 years. The satellite body is a 6-sided prism with a height of and a width of . Fajr was launched by a Safir-1B rocket from the Iranian Space Agency's launch site in Semnan city. The launch took place at around 08:50:00 UTC on 2 February 2015, Iran's national day of space and the sixth anniversary of the country's first successful orbital launch.
